Description

The most beautiful book of Space Shuttle photography ever published. This inside look at the preparation, launching and landing of the shuttles features rare behind the scenes footage from Kennedy Space Center in photos by James Brown. Includes special audio features allowing you to hear James describe the story behind many photos and a full screen slide show of a Day on The Pad with Endeavour. High resolution images look spectacular on your iPad.
